The Role of Granular Synthesis

Granular synthesis plays a crucial role in achieving this textural depth. This technique involves breaking down audio into tiny particles, known as ‘grains’, and then rearranging and manipulating these grains to create new sounds. It allows for the creation of incredibly complex and evolving textures that are difficult, if not impossible, to achieve using traditional synthesis methods. Many emerging producers are now incorporating granular synthesis into their workflows, directly inspired by the soundscapes created by the artist and aiming for comparable immersive results. It’s a powerful tool for those seeking to create unique and otherworldly soundscapes.

Exploring Microtiming and Humanization

A significant aspect of this rhythmic approach is the subtle use of microtiming – slight variations in the timing of individual notes – and humanization – adding imperfections to make the rhythm feel more natural and organic. These seemingly small details can have a huge impact on the overall feel of the music, making it sound less robotic and more alive. Producers are now actively experimenting with microtiming and humanization tools in their DAWs, mirroring the nuanced rhythmic feel of the artist’s soundtracks. This is a departure from the quantized perfection that often characterizes electronic music.

Vocal as Texture: Deconstruction and Re-Synthesis

A common technique is to deconstruct the vocal performance, isolating individual syllables or even phonemes, and then re-synthesizing them into new sounds. This provides a unique sonic palette and allows for the creation of vocal textures that are unlike anything heard before. It's a testament to the artistic vision — and the technical skill — involved in producing this kind of music. This trend has encouraged producers to see the vocal track not only as a carrier of lyrical content, but also as a source of raw sonic material.
